What is PETG Film?


PETG (Polyethylene Terephthalate Glycol) film is a type of thermoplastic polymer known for its excellent durability, clarity, and versatility. It is made by modifying standard PET to include glycol, which prevents crystallization and makes the film easier to work with. This modification enhances the film's properties, making it an ideal material for various applications, including furniture design.

The Benefits of High Glossy PETG Film


High glossy PETG film is particularly prized for its ability to enhance the visual appeal of furniture. The glossy finish gives furniture panels a sleek, reflective surface that adds depth and dimension to the design. Beyond aesthetics, this film is also highly durable, providing a protective layer that guards against scratches, UV rays, and general wear and tear. Additionally, its smooth surface makes it easy to clean and maintain, ensuring that the furniture retains its pristine look over time.


Why Choose PETG Film for Furniture Panels?


When it comes to selecting materials for furniture panels, PETG film stands out for several reasons. Compared to traditional materials like wood veneer or PVC film, PETG offers superior durability and environmental benefits. It is resistant to moisture and temperature changes, making it ideal for use in various environments. Furthermore, PETG is a more sustainable option, as it can be recycled and has a lower environmental impact compared to other synthetic materials.

How PETG Film is Applied to Furniture Panels


The process of applying PETG film to furniture panels involves several steps to ensure a smooth, high-gloss finish. This process, often referred to as gilding, includes preparing the panel surface, applying an adhesive layer, and then carefully laminating the PETG film onto the surface. Specialized equipment is used to achieve a flawless finish, free of bubbles or imperfections. The result is a beautiful, durable panel that enhances the overall look of the furniture.

Popular Applications of Wood Grain High Glossy PETG Film


Wood grain high glossy PETG film is incredibly versatile, making it suitable for a variety of furniture applications. In residential settings, it is often used for kitchen cabinets, wardrobes, and entertainment units. In commercial and retail spaces, it adds a touch of elegance to display units, reception desks, and shelving. Office furniture, such as desks and conference tables, also benefit from the sophisticated look of this film.

Durability and Longevity of PETG Film in Furniture


The durability of PETG film is one of its key selling points. It is highly resistant to scratches, impact, and UV rays, ensuring that furniture maintains its appearance even after years of use. This makes PETG film an excellent choice for high-traffic areas and environments where furniture is subject to daily wear and tear. Additionally, the film's long-term performance means that furniture panels will not need to be replaced or refinished frequently, offering cost savings in the long run.



Comparing PETG Film with Other Furniture Finishes


When choosing a finish for furniture panels, it’s helpful to compare PETG film with other popular options:


  • PETG vs. PVC Film: PETG film offers better clarity and gloss compared to PVC film. It is also more environmentally friendly and does not contain harmful plasticizers.


  • PETG vs. Veneer: While wood veneer provides a natural wood finish, PETG film is more durable and resistant to moisture, making it a better choice for areas with fluctuating temperatures or humidity.


  • PETG vs. Melamine: Melamine is a budget-friendly option, but it lacks the high-gloss finish and durability of PETG film. PETG also offers more customization options.


Environmental Impact of Using PETG Film


The environmental impact of materials is an important consideration in modern furniture design. PETG film is considered a more sustainable option due to its recyclability and lower carbon footprint compared to other synthetic materials. Additionally, the durability of PETG film means that furniture pieces have a longer lifespan, reducing the need for frequent replacements and contributing to waste reduction.
